Sonographer Job Summary<\/strong><\/h3>\n

\"ArchieThere are multiple professional titles for ultrasound techs (technicians). They are also referred to as sonogram techs, diagnostic medical sonographers (or just sonographers) and ultrasound technologists. Regardless of name, they all have the same basic job description, which is to implement diagnostic ultrasound procedures on patients. Even though a number of techs practice as generalists there are specializations within the field, for instance in cardiology and pediatrics.
